

Nancy Weeks Risch, beloved daughter of Joan Webber and Ralph Lang, passed away March 9th. Her 85 adventurous years began in Illinois where she graduated from Evanston Township High School. At Stephens College in Columbia, MO she earned her pilot’s license, and met her lifelong love and husband of 65 years, Ted Risch. Her goal was to become a member of the WAF and fly military aircraft to Europe. She and Ted were married upon his return from the Pacific in 1946.
As a loving mother and homemaker she accompanied Ted to Wilton, CT where she promptly joined the Pakalana Hula Troop and performed in many venues. She and Ted enjoyed dinner and theater in New York City and skiing with their children at Grey Rocks Inn in Ste. Jovit, Canada. Moving to Gulf Breeze in 1968 Nancy became an avid and accomplished tennis player, winning many local tournaments. As a member of Gulf Breeze United Methodist Church she at one time served as President of their UMW and later became a Conference officer. She was a devoted longtime member of the church choir. Following her fun loving nature, she studied tap dancing in later life.
Nancy’s positive and determined spirit was loved by many people. She is survived by her husband, three children, Susan Tocher and Tom Risch of Boulder, CO, Ted Risch of Gulf Breeze, five grand children and two great grandaughters.
